Nashville offers a variety of hotel clusters, each catering to different experiences and travelers. Downtown in SoBro is perfect for those wanting to be in the heart of the action, with upscale hotels, trendy bars, and easy access to Broadwayās live music scene š¶. Music Valley, near Opryland, is ideal for country music lovers, offering resorts and family-friendly accommodations close to the Grand Ole Opry šø. If convenience is key, Elm Hill Pike near the airport provides budget-friendly stays and quick access for business travelers or those with early flights āļø. Midtown strikes a balance between lively nightlife š» and a laid-back atmosphere, with boutique hotels near Vanderbilt University. East Nashville, on the other hand, embraces its artistic and indie vibe šØ, featuring unique stays that reflect the area’s creative energy. No matter your preference, Nashvilleās diverse hotel clusters ensure thereās a perfect spot to match your style and itinerary!
